Abstract :
State- and output-feedback solutions of H control problem are derived using the bounded real lemma. Because the approach uses only this lemma and algebraic operations, proof of the results is simple and clear. Several specific state-feedback H control problems, and some properties of their central controllers, such as gain margin and phase margin, are shown
